Extension of simultaneous Diophantine approximation algorithm for partial approximate common divisor variants
Abstract A simultaneous Diophantine approximation (SDA) algorithm takes instances of the partial approximate common divisor (PACD) problem as input and outputs a solution. While several encryption schemes have been published and their securities depend on the presumed hardness of variant of the PACD...
